Common Residential & Commercial Roofing Scams in Deming

Be aware of these tactic used by unlicensed operators

🚫

Storm Chaser Scams

Contractors appear after storms claiming to inspect for 'hidden damage.' They may create actual damage to justify unnecessary repairs or use high-pressure tactics to get you to sign insurance claim paperwork.

🚫

Material Switching Scams

Contractors quote premium materials but install cheaper, inferior products. They may show you quality samples but use substandard materials that won't withstand Deming's weather conditions.

🚫

Insurance Fraud Schemes

Contractors offer to handle your insurance claim and suggest inflating damage or claiming unrelated issues. They may pressure you to sign over insurance benefits or assignment of benefits (AOB) forms.

🚫

Deposit Disappearance

Contractors demand large deposits (often 50% or more) for 'material purchases' then disappear or delay work indefinitely. They may provide excuses about supply chain issues while using your money for other purposes.

How to Verify a Professional

1

Insurance

Request a Certificate of Insurance (COI) directly from their insurance provider. Verify they carry both liability insurance and workers' compensation coverage. This protects you if accidents occur on your property.

2

Licensing

Check the Washington State Department of Labor & Industries website to verify roofing contractor licensing. All roofing contractors in Washington must be registered and bonded. Ask for their contractor registration number and verify it online before signing anything.

3

References

Ask for recent local references in the Deming area and actually contact them. Visit completed projects if possible. Check online reviews across multiple platforms, but be aware that fake reviews often have similar patterns and timing.

Protection FAQs

What should I do if a roofing contractor shows up unannounced?

Politely decline any immediate inspections or estimates. Tell them you only work with pre-screened contractors. Take their business card if offered, but do not let them on your roof or property without proper vetting first.

How much should I pay as a deposit for roofing work?

In Washington, reasonable deposits are typically 10-30% of the total project cost. Be wary of contractors demanding 50% or more upfront. Legitimate contractors understand reasonable payment schedules tied to project milestones.

What roofing licenses are required in Deming, WA?

All roofing contractors must be registered with the Washington State Department of Labor & Industries. They need a contractor registration number and must be bonded. Specialized roofing may require additional certifications. Always verify licensing online before hiring.

Should I be concerned about contractors offering 'today only' discounts?

Yes, high-pressure sales tactics are major red flags. Legitimate contractors provide written estimates that remain valid for reasonable periods (typically 30-90 days). Pressure to decide immediately often indicates a scam.

What questions should I ask before hiring a roofing contractor?

Ask for: 1) Washington contractor registration number, 2) Certificate of Insurance, 3) Local references in Deming/Whatcom County, 4) Detailed written contract, 5) Manufacturer warranty information, 6) Who will supervise the project, and 7) Cleanup and disposal procedures.

How can I verify a roofing contractor's insurance is current?

Request a Certificate of Insurance (COI) sent directly from their insurance provider to you. Contact the insurance company to verify the policy is active and covers the scope of your project. Don't accept photocopies or verbal assurances.
